In Respiratory tract infection Gaity A Tablet helps treat respiratory tract infection by killing the bacteria causing infection. It also helps to loosen thick mucus, making it easier to cough out. This reduces congestion or stuffiness and helps in easy breathing. This medicine usually starts to work within a few minutes and the effects can last up to several hours. Along with medications, drink enough lukewarm water and gargle with warm salt water to feel better.
It is unsafe to consume alcohol with Gaity A Tablet.
Gaity A Tablet may be unsafe to use during pregnancy. Although there are limited studies in humans, animal studies have shown harmful effects on the developing baby. Your doctor will weigh the benefits and any potential risks before prescribing it to you. Please consult your doctor.
Information regarding the use of Gaity A Tablet during breastfeeding is not available. Please consult your doctor.
Gaity A Tablet may cause side effects which could affect your ability to drive. The most common side effects that can occur when taking Gaity A Tablet are usually mild nausea, vomiting, stomach ache, diarrhea, dizziness, and headache.This may affect your ability to drive.
Gaity A Tablet should be used with caution in patients with kidney disease. Dose adjustment of Gaity A Tablet may be needed. Please consult your doctor. Take plenty of water while you are taking this medicine
Gaity A Tablet should be used with caution in patients with liver disease. Dose adjustment of Gaity A Tablet may be needed. Please consult your doctor.
If you miss a dose of Gaity A Tablet, take it as soon as possible. However, if it is almost time for your next dose, skip the missed dose and go back to your regular schedule. Do not double the dose.
